A Radiologic Technician or Technologist operates X Ray, MRI (Magnetic Resonance Imaging) or CT (Computed Tomography) scan equipment to take diagnostic images of a patient. Works with doctors to obtain specific images necessary for medical diagnosis.

This is a Mon-Fri 8:30am-5:30pm position for a multispecialty Orthopedic practice A typical day for an X-Ray Technician may include: Performing high-quality diagnostic imaging procedures while following established protocols to support accurate and timely diagnoses Preparing patients for imaging exams by explaining procedures, answering questions, and ensuring their comfort and safety throughout the process Positioning patients accurately and operating radiologic equipment to obtain optimal diagnostic images while minimizing radiation exposure Applying radiation safety principles and maintaining compliance with regulatory standards to protect patients, colleagues, and yourself Reviewing images for quality and completeness, identifying the need for additional views when appropriate, and communicating with radiologists and providers Accurately documenting imaging procedures, patient information, and exam details within the electronic medical record and imaging systems Collaborating with physicians, nurses, and other members of the healthcare team to coordinate patient care and ensure efficient workflow Maintaining imaging equipment, monitoring supplies, and reporting equipment concerns to support uninterrupted patient care Pursuing continued professional development through continuing education, advanced imaging opportunities, and organizational resources that support long-term career growth This role might be for you if: Clear, compassionate communication defines how you interact with patients, families, and colleagues Attention to detail and technical precision guide your work every day You remain calm and adaptable while managing a fast-paced clinical environment Patient safety and delivering high-quality diagnostic imaging are your top priorities You enjoy working collaboratively with providers and interdisciplinary care teams Continuous learning and professional growth motivate you Creating a positive, reassuring patient experience is central to your approach To be considered for this X-Ray Technician opportunity, you must: Minimum one year experience in an x-ray department in a hospital or physician's office 1-3 experience as an x-ray technician performing diagnostic radiography Graduate of an AMA approved School of Radiologic Technology Hold a current American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ification Hold an active New Jersey Radiologic Technologist license (NJDEP) Maintains required BLS Heart Saver/Health Care Provider through American Heart Association Epic knowledge is a plus Working with Carestream XR machine and Horizon Health Care PACS is a plus Experience with non-weightbearing patients/stretcher patients is a plus Knowledge of leg length series is a plus At RWJBarnabas Health, our market-competitive Total Rewards package provides comprehensive benefits and resources to support our employees physical, emotional, social, and financial health.
